The core of any successful casino’s profitability lies in the house edge. This mathematical advantage is inherent in every game offered, ensuring that over a large volume of play, the casino will always retain a portion of the wagers. Understanding and accurately calculating this edge for each game, from slots to table games like blackjack and roulette, is paramount. It allows operators to set appropriate payout structures that are attractive to players while still guaranteeing long-term financial viability.

Strategic Game Selection and Management

The choice of games available and how they are managed directly impacts a casino’s revenue streams. Offering a diverse portfolio caters to a wider range of player preferences, from high-stakes gamblers to casual players. However, each game must be carefully monitored for its contribution to the overall house advantage. Games with a higher house edge, when played frequently, are more lucrative, but they must be balanced with games that offer a perceived better chance for the player to maintain engagement.

Beyond the initial selection, ongoing management is crucial. This includes adjusting betting limits, monitoring game performance, and even introducing new games or variations to keep the offering fresh and exciting. The dynamic nature of player preferences means that casinos must be agile, adapting their game offerings to meet evolving demands while always ensuring that their profitability remains at the forefront of strategic decisions. This constant evaluation is a key differentiator for thriving establishments.

Leveraging Player Data and Customer Loyalty

In the modern casino landscape, data is king. Collecting and analyzing player data allows for a nuanced understanding of customer behavior, preferences, and spending habits. This information is invaluable for tailoring promotions, personalizing experiences, and identifying high-value patrons. Implementing robust loyalty programs incentivizes repeat business and fosters a sense of community around the casino, further solidifying its revenue base.

The insights gleaned from player data go beyond simple tracking; they inform strategic marketing campaigns and operational adjustments. For instance, understanding which games are popular at certain times can lead to optimized staffing and resource allocation. Similarly, identifying players who are predisposed to certain types of bonuses allows for targeted offers that maximize engagement and spending, creating a more efficient and profitable operational model. This data-driven approach is a cornerstone of sustained success.

Creating an Unforgettable Gaming Environment

The physical and atmospheric elements of a casino play a significant role in its success. Beyond the games themselves, the ambiance, customer service, and entertainment offerings contribute to an immersive experience that encourages patrons to stay longer and spend more. This can include well-appointed decor, attentive staff, comfortable seating, and a variety of dining and entertainment options that complement the gaming floor.

A well-designed casino floor layout can subtly guide players through different gaming areas, increasing exposure to various attractions. Furthermore, professional and friendly staff are essential for resolving issues, providing assistance, and making guests feel valued. This holistic approach to the guest experience is not merely about providing games, but about crafting an enjoyable and memorable outing that translates directly into increased player retention and revenue for the establishment.
